About This Book

Tommy Bomani is an ordinary sixth grader who uncovers an extraordinary secret: he can change into a cat! As he explores his newfound magical powers, Tommy also learns about his heritage as a descendant of ancient Egyptian warriors. Adventure and mystery await as he embraces his unique identity.

Why we rated Tommy Bomani 9C

Tommy Bomani is written at a Level 4-5 reading level across 112 pages (approximately 18,614 words). Strong independent readers around grade 5.8 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Tommy Bomani works for readers up to grade 6.8.

Read aloud, Tommy Bomani runs about 2.1 hours — long enough to span several bedtime sessions.

We rate Tommy Bomani as 9C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.

Thematically, Tommy Bomani explores fantasy world-building, adventure, coming of age, multicultural, and human-animal relationships —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
